What is an ADHD Assessment?
An ADHD assessment normally involves numerous elements, including:
- Clinical Interview: A health care service provider will conduct a substantial interview covering individual history, behavior patterns, and issues.
- Behavioral Rating Scales: Parents, teachers, or other involved individuals might complete questionnaires to provide more insights into the person’s behavior.
- Cognitive Testing: Tests to determine attention period, memory, and executive performance might be carried out.
- Observation: Direct observation may occur in numerous settings to see how the private functions in genuine time.
Significance of Diagnosis
Correct diagnosis is essential, as it not just informs treatment alternatives but also helps in understanding the person’s strengths and weaknesses. ADHD signs can frequently overlap with other conditions, making it essential for the assessment to be thorough and precise.

Navigating the Insurance Process
The procedure of utilizing private health insurance for an ADHD assessment can involve several crucial steps:
Step-by-Step Guide
-
Review Your Insurance Policy:
- Check if ADHD assessments are covered under your health insurance.
- Determine any co-pays or deductible requirements.
-
Recognize In-Network Providers:
- Use your insurance provider’s database to find competent psychologists or psychiatrists who can perform the assessment.
-
Make an Appointment:
- Once a company is picked, set up a visit for assessment. Make certain to ask for a clear explanation of expenses upfront.
-
Send Claims and Verify Coverage:
- Keep a record of all payments and send claims to your insurance as needed.
Essential Considerations
- Referral Requirement: Some insurance plans may require a referral from a basic professional before setting up an assessment.
- Pre-Authorization: To prevent unforeseen expenses, examine if pre-authorization is required, particularly for more comprehensive assessments.
- Limits and Exclusions: Be aware of limits on the number of sees or particular exclusions related to ADHD assessments.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ION
Q1: How much does an ADHD assessment typically cost?
A: The cost of an ADHD assessment can differ extensively, ranging from ₤ 300 to ₤ 2,500, depending on the intricacy of the evaluation and the provider’s rates. Insurance may reduce these costs significantly.
Q2: Can I switch my supplier if my existing one is not covered?
A: Yes, if you discover that your present service provider is not covered under your insurance network, you can select another in-network provider for the assessment.
Q3: Will my insurance cover ADHD medications after assessment?
A: Typically, the majority of insurance policies will offer protection for medications recommended following an ADHD assessment. Nevertheless, it is recommended to validate coverage specifics with your insurance provider.
Q4: How long does an ADHD assessment take?
A: The procedure can take a few hours to complete, but it might span numerous gos to, particularly if extensive testing is needed.
Q5: What if I do not have insurance?
A: If you don’t have insurance, you may consider neighborhood resources, sliding scale centers, or looking for financial help programs that can assist cover the costs of ADHD assessments.
